Republican presidential candidate Donald Trump is in near-perfect physical condition according to a letter written by his physician posted on the GOP front-runner’s website.

The letter, written by Trump’s long-time physician Harold Bernstein, claims Trump has “no significant medical problems.”

“Over the past twelve months, he has lost at least fifteen pounds,” the letter reads. “Mr. Trump takes 81 mg of aspirin daily and a low dose of statin. His PSA test score is 0.15 (very low). His physical strength and stamina are extraordinary.”

One of Trump’s go-to attack lines against his fellow presidential foes is they lack stamina or they are too low energy.

People have been impressed by my stamina, but to me it has been easy because I am truly doing something that I love. Our country will soon be better and stronger than ever before,” Trump says in a statement.

Trump regularly criticizes both Jeb Bush and Ben Carson for being low-energy individuals. In November, Trump said Democratic presidential candidate Hillary Clinton lacks the stamina to be president.

“Hillary is a person who doesn’t have the strength or the stamina, in my opinion, to be president. She doesn’t have strength or stamina. She’s not a strong enough person to be president,” Trump said.

In his letter, Bornstein says he has been Trump’s personal physician since 1980, and prior to that Bornstein’s father served that role. During his time, Bornstein says Trump has had no significant medical problems.

“His cardiovascular strength is excellent. He has no history of ever using alcohol or tobacco products,” Bornstein writes.

“If elected, Mr. Trump, I can state unequivocally, will be the healthiest individual ever elected to the presidency.”
